Passenger Transport

Safety systems for public, private, and managed passenger transport operations

Passenger transport operations involve the movement of people through busy, dynamic environments where safety, reliability, and passenger experience must be carefully balanced. SCC’s safety systems are designed to support passenger transport operators by improving visibility, reducing risk to passengers and the public, and enabling dependable safety performance without disrupting service delivery or vehicle interiors.

  • Urban streets and town centres
  • Transport interchanges, stops, and terminals
  • Schools, colleges, hospitals, and care facilities
  • Tourist destinations, venues, and event locations
  • Mixed urban, suburban, and regional routes

What challenges do passenger transport operators face?

Passenger transport fleets face operational challenges driven by vehicle utilisation, passenger interaction, and service expectations. These challenges include:

  • Frequent low-speed manoeuvres and regular stopping
  • High exposure to pedestrians, cyclists, and vulnerable road users
  • Passenger boarding and alighting in constrained environments
  • Maintaining interior condition and accessibility features
  • Operation by multiple drivers across shifts and duty cycles
  • Limited tolerance for downtime in scheduled and contracted services

Addressing these challenges requires safety systems that are reliable, intuitive, and suitable for continuous daily operation.

How do SCC’s safety systems support passenger transport operations?

SCC’s safety systems for passenger transport operations are designed to improve driver awareness whilst respecting the people-focused nature of passenger services. This is achieved through:

  • Camera systems providing rear and side visibility
  • Support for safe manoeuvring at stops, kerbsides, and terminals
  • In-cab visual and audible alerts to assist driver awareness
  • Integration with SCC’s wider suite of safety systems, including proximity sensing where required
  • Bespoke system configurations aligned with service type and operating environment

Solutions are engineered to deliver consistent performance across high-utilisation passenger fleets.

Supporting non-invasive installation and service continuity

Passenger transport vehicles are designed around accessibility, interior presentation, and passenger comfort. Invasive installation work can disrupt services, compromise interiors, and increase vehicle downtime.

SCC’s safety systems can be implemented using X-Wire, which enables camera and sensor signals to be transmitted over the vehicle’s existing electrical wiring. This reduces the need to route additional data cabling through passenger compartments or interior finishes.

By supporting low-disruption installation and simplified maintenance, SCC’s safety systems help passenger transport operators maintain service continuity and vehicle presentation.

Installation and operational suitability

SCC’s safety systems can be installed on new passenger transport vehicles or retrofitted to existing fleets, supporting mixed vehicle ages and specifications. Installations are designed to respect interior layouts, accessibility requirements, and service schedules.

Each solution is configured to reflect operational priorities, passenger environments, and safety objectives.

Compliance and operational support

Safety systems fitted to passenger transport vehicles can support wider fleet safety strategies and alignment with applicable public transport, urban safety, and safeguarding requirements where relevant. SCC’s solutions are designed for dependable long-term operation, helping operators demonstrate a consistent and responsible approach to passenger safety.

Other Industries:

Construction and Infrastructure

Construction and Infrastructure

Refuse and Waste

Refuse and Waste

Freight, Logistics and Distribution

Freight, Logistics and Distribution

Defence and Secure Operations

Defence and Secure Operations

Ports and Terminals

Ports and Terminals
No results found.

Explore More Resources

Looking to dive deeper? Whether you want to see how our technology performs in the real world, understand compliance requirements like DVS, or get answers to key safety questions — we’ve got you covered.

Visit our Learning Centre to browse our latest FAQs, Comparisons, Case Studies and other useful information to help you make informed decisions about improving vehicle safety across your fleet.